Dahul - Jawhar, Palghar

Dahul is a village situated in the Jawhar tehsil of Palghar district, Maharashtra. It is located approximately 35 km from Jawhar and around 155 km from Thane. Dabheri serves as the Village Panchayat for Dahul village.

As per Census 2011, the village code of Dahul is 551849. The village covers a total geographical area of 319 hectares and falls under the 401603 pincode. Jawhar is the nearest town, located about 35 km away.

Dahul village is governed under the Panchayati Raj system, with a Sarpanch serving as the elected head. For political representation, the village falls under the Vikramgad Vidhan Sabha (Assembly) constituency and the Palghar Lok Sabha (Parliamentary) constituency.

Population of Dahul

According to the 2011 Census, Dahul village had a total population of 267 people, including 129 males and 138 females, living in 54 households. The sex ratio was 1,070 females per 1,000 males. The overall literacy rate was 33.33%, with male literacy at 37.76% and female literacy at 29.00%. The Scheduled Tribe (ST) population was 267.

Transport and Connectivity of Dahul

Dahul is connected by an all-weather road, and public transport is mainly available through bus services. The nearest railway station is Bhilad, while the nearest airport is Chhatrapati Shivaji International Airport, situated at an approximate aerial distance of 91.7 km.
